Jammu: The Jammu and Kashmir National Conference General Secretary Ali Muhammad Sagar on Sunday denounced the delimitation commission’s second draft proposal, saying the party will not accept attempts to divide people of J&K.

Sagar, according to the NC spokesperson, said this while presiding over a meeting held at Sher-e-Kashmir Bhawan, Jammu. “Among others Provincial Presidents Nasir Aslam Wani, Rattan Lal Gupta, senior leaders Choudhary Mohammad Ramzaan, Mubarak Gul, Sakina Itoo, Nazir Gurezi, Kashmir Zone Presidents Dr Bashir Veeri, Javed Dar, VPs Province Kashmir Mohammad Syed Akhoon, Ahsan Pardesi, DPs Altaf Wani, AB Majeed Larmi and other leaders were also president on the occasion.”

Interacting with the functionaries, Sagar said, “The draft recommendations are bizarre. The panel has gone by its own wish. It’s a sheer mockery of universally accepted and constitutionally established norms of representation.”

“NC party will consult all provincial, zonal, district functionaries before submitting its objections by 14 February. We will formulate a detailed response to this report based on the inputs from the constituency in charge and submit it to the commission,” he added.
